Average salary in Ukraine up 30% in April 2021

Ukrinform
The average nominal salary of Ukrainians in April 2021 was 29.8% higher than the one they received in April 2020 and amounted to UAH 13,543, the State Statistics Service has reported.

The average nominal salary of a full-time employee of enterprises, institutions and organizations in April 2021 was UAH 13,543, or 2.3 times higher than the minimum wage (UAH 6,000). Compared to March 2021, the average nominal salary shrank by 0.5%.

The highest average nominal salary in April 2021 was recorded in the field of information and telecommunications (on average UAH 27,101, up 48% from April 2020), in the sphere of financial and insurance activities (UAH 23,557, up 16.3%), and in the field of professional, scientific and technical activities (UAH 21,883, up 47.8%).

The lowest average nominal salary in April 2021 was recorded in the field of temporary accommodation and catering (UAH 6,979, up 99.4% from April 2020), administrative and support services (UAH 10,678, up 15.3%), and education (UAH 10,859, up 30.7%).

According to the State Statistics Service, the average nominal salary in April 2020 was UAH 10,430 in Ukraine, or 1.6% higher than in April 2019.
